[ovs-dev] [PATCH] automake: ofp-errors.inc is generated inside srcdir

Ben Pfaff blp at nicira.com
Tue Mar 19 19:22:31 UTC 2013


From: Damien Millescamps <damien.millescamps at 6wind.com>

This patch fixes a build error when OVS is built from a
read-only repository.

To reproduce this issue run:
chmod -R a-w .
mkdir ../build-ovs; cd ../build-ovs
../openvswitch/configure && make

Signed-off-by: Damien Millescamps <damien.millescamps at 6wind.com>
---
Reposting for Damien because of email issues.

 lib/automake.mk |    6 +++---
 1 files changed, 3 insertions(+), 3 deletions(-)

diff --git a/lib/automake.mk b/lib/automake.mk
index 1d58604..7eb214f 100644
--- a/lib/automake.mk
+++ b/lib/automake.mk
@@ -332,11 +332,11 @@ lib/dirs.c: lib/dirs.c.in Makefile
 	     > lib/dirs.c.tmp
 	mv lib/dirs.c.tmp lib/dirs.c
 
-$(srcdir)/lib/ofp-errors.inc: \
-	lib/ofp-errors.h $(srcdir)/build-aux/extract-ofp-errors
+lib/ofp-errors.inc: \
+	$(srcdir)/lib/ofp-errors.h $(srcdir)/build-aux/extract-ofp-errors
 	$(run_python) $(srcdir)/build-aux/extract-ofp-errors \
 		$(srcdir)/lib/ofp-errors.h > $@.tmp && mv $@.tmp $@
-$(srcdir)/lib/ofp-errors.c: $(srcdir)/lib/ofp-errors.inc
+$(srcdir)/lib/ofp-errors.c: lib/ofp-errors.inc
 EXTRA_DIST += build-aux/extract-ofp-errors lib/ofp-errors.inc
 
 $(srcdir)/lib/ofp-msgs.inc: \
-- 
1.7.2.5




More information about the dev mailing list